Bug 6988: addVpnUser did not camel case the "username" which resulted in that particular value not being returned.

This commit is contained in:
will 2010-11-04 12:06:21 -07:00
parent bd4f3bfaa0
commit 70b4c4d181
4 changed files with 9 additions and 7 deletions

View File

@ -36,7 +36,7 @@ import com.cloud.user.UserContext;
public class AddVpnUserCmd extends BaseAsyncCmd {
public static final Logger s_logger = Logger.getLogger(AddVpnUserCmd.class.getName());
private static final String s_name = "addvpnuserresponse";
private static final String s_name = "vpnuser";
/////////////////////////////////////////////////////
//////////////// API parameters /////////////////////
@ -97,7 +97,7 @@ public class AddVpnUserCmd extends BaseAsyncCmd {
VpnUserVO vpnUser = (VpnUserVO)getResponseObject();
VpnUsersResponse vpnResponse = new VpnUsersResponse();
vpnResponse.setId(vpnUser.getId());
vpnResponse.setUsername(vpnUser.getUsername());
vpnResponse.setUserName(vpnUser.getUsername());
vpnResponse.setAccountName(vpnUser.getAccountName());
Account accountTemp = ApiDBUtils.findAccountById(vpnUser.getAccountId());

View File

@ -92,7 +92,7 @@ public class ListVpnUsersCmd extends BaseListCmd {
for (VpnUserVO vpnUser : vpnUsers) {
VpnUsersResponse vpnResponse = new VpnUsersResponse();
vpnResponse.setId(vpnUser.getId());
vpnResponse.setUsername(vpnUser.getUsername());
vpnResponse.setUserName(vpnUser.getUsername());
vpnResponse.setAccountName(vpnUser.getAccountName());
Account accountTemp = ApiDBUtils.findAccountById(vpnUser.getAccountId());

View File

@ -48,11 +48,11 @@ public class VpnUsersResponse extends BaseResponse {
this.id = id;
}
public String getUsername() {
public String getUserName() {
return userName;
}
public void setUsername(String name) {
public void setUserName(String name) {
this.userName = name;
}
@ -78,5 +78,7 @@ public class VpnUsersResponse extends BaseResponse {
return domainName;
}
public String toString() {
return "id: " + getId() + ", username: " + getUserName() + ", account: " + getAccountName() + ", domainid: " + getDomainId();
}
}

View File

@ -512,7 +512,7 @@ function showVpnUsers() {
if (result.jobstatus == 1) { // Succeeded
$thisDialog.dialog("close");
$("#tab_content_vpn #grid_content").append(vpnUserJsonToTemplate(result.jobresult.addvpnuserresponse).fadeIn());
$("#tab_content_vpn #grid_content").append(vpnUserJsonToTemplate(result.jobresult.vpnuser).fadeIn());
} else if (result.jobstatus == 2) { // Failed
var errorMsg = "We were unable to add user access to your VPN. Please contact support.";
$thisDialog.find("#info_container").text(errorMsg).show();